Revenue of Israeli Marketing Chains Up 3.7%
Israel's marketing chains reported a 3.7% revenue increase from November 2025 to January 2026, according to the Central Bureau of Statistics.
Jerusalem, 12 March, 2026 (TPS-IL) — Revenue (sales) of Israel’s marketing chains in the months of November 2025-January 2026 (annualized trend data), saw an increase of 3.7% (at constant prices) in total retail chain revenue, after an increase of 6.6% (at constant prices) in the three months August-October 2025. This is according to data released by Israel’s Central Bureau of Statistics.
There was also a 3.1% increase (at constant prices) in food chain revenue, after a 3.6% increase (at constant prices) in August – October 2025.
In 2025, the total revenue of retail chains at fixed prices increased by 2.6%, compared to 2024; this follows an increase of 7.2% in 2024.
In 2025, food chain revenue increased by 0.9% at constant prices, compared to 2024; this followed an increase of 2.7% in 2024.
